Meet your dog’s best friend for solo play time! Watch them jump, hurl, and tugg the Tree Tugger for hours! The Tree Tugger perfectly simulates a game of tug-a-war for any size dog by using the included Jolly Jumper or attaching your pup’s favorite toy. The Tree Tugger is great for heavy chewers because you can adjust the height so your pup can’t sit and chew it constantly. Simulates a game of tug-a-war for any size dog Use the included Jolly Jumper or attach your pup’s favorite toy Great for heavy chewers Adjustable height so your pup can’t sit and chew also.

Victoria Jones –
Potentially VERY dangerous
I usually do not review things on Amazon, but this toy seems to have the potential to be very unsafe. My dog thoroughly enjoyed it, and while being supervised managed to get her paw wrapped up in the loop that the ball is in. If unsupervised, this could be very dangerous. I am thankful it was just her paw and not her head or neck. Be very careful if using and make sure your dog is under continuous supervision. A little misleading since this toy is advertised as “solo play for dogs” even though it does say not to leave your dog unattended with it.
